PAY ON SATURDAY

ALTERATION IN SYSTEM FOR RELIEF WOREERS COUNCIL DECISION The Rotorua Borough Council last evening decided to alter its present system and pay all relief workers in its empToy on Saturdays instead of on Mondays as at present. The change was made at the request of the Rotorua Relief Workers' Asso.ciation which pointed out that the fact that the men could not obtain their wages before the week-end, in many cases entailed real hardship. Cr. E. T. Johnson supported the request and pointed out that the County Council was at present paying on Satufdays. The Mayor, Mr. T. Jackson, said that he thought the change would assist the men and that it might be given a trial. It would be possible to make the payments on a Saturday under the new1 2, 3 and 4 day system, but it had not been possible previously under the five -day week, as returns could not be completed in time. It was decided to inst-itute the change for a trial period. •
